1. Utilizing Content Marketing for Patient Engagement

Content marketing is a powerful strategy to engage patients and provide them with valuable information. By creating high-quality, informative content, healthcare providers can position themselves as thought leaders in their industry and build trust with their audience.

To effectively utilize content marketing, it’s important to understand your target audience and their needs. Conducting thorough research and creating buyer personas can help tailor your content to resonate with your specific patient demographic. Whether it’s blog posts, videos, or infographics, content should be informative, engaging, and easy to consume.

2. Leveraging Social Media for Healthcare Marketing

Social media platforms have become an integral part of our daily lives, and healthcare providers can leverage these platforms to connect with patients on a personal level. By creating engaging social media content, such as health tips, patient stories, and educational videos, healthcare providers can foster a sense of community and encourage patient interaction.

It’s important to choose the right social media platforms based on your target audience demographics. For example, Facebook is great for reaching a wider audience, while platforms like Instagram and TikTok may be more effective for targeting younger demographics. Consistency, authenticity, and active engagement with followers are key to successful social media marketing.

3. Implementing Email Marketing in Healthcare Marketing Services

Email marketing remains a highly effective strategy for patient engagement. By building an email list of interested patients, healthcare providers can send personalized, targeted messages to nurture relationships and encourage ongoing engagement.

Segmentation is crucial in email marketing to ensure that patients receive relevant content. By categorizing patients based on their interests, demographics, or health conditions, healthcare providers can deliver tailored messages that resonate with each individual. Personalization, compelling subject lines, and clear calls to action are essential for effective email marketing in healthcare.

4. The Role of Search Engine Optimization (SEO) in Healthcare Marketing

In today’s digital age, patients often turn to search engines when looking for healthcare information or services. Implementing SEO techniques can help healthcare providers improve their online visibility and attract organic traffic to their website.

Keyword research is the foundation of SEO. By identifying relevant keywords and incorporating them into website content, meta tags, and headings, healthcare providers can increase their chances of ranking higher in search engine results. Additionally, optimizing website speed, mobile responsiveness, and user experience are important factors that influence search engine rankings and patient engagement.

5. Maximizing Online Reviews and Testimonials for Patient Engagement

Online reviews and testimonials have become a powerful tool in healthcare marketing. Patients trust the opinions and experiences of their peers, and positive reviews can significantly impact a healthcare provider’s reputation and patient acquisition.

Encouraging patients to leave reviews and testimonials can be achieved through various methods. This includes sending follow-up emails after appointments, creating a seamless review process on the website or third-party review platforms, and incentivizing patients to share their experiences. Responding to reviews, both positive and negative, shows that the healthcare provider values patient feedback and is committed to providing excellent care.

6. Utilizing Patient Portals and Mobile Apps for Healthcare Marketing

Patient portals and mobile apps offer convenient ways for patients to access their healthcare information, communicate with their providers, and engage in their own care. Implementing these technologies not only enhances patient experience but also increases engagement and loyalty.

Patient portals provide a secure platform for patients to view their medical records, schedule appointments, and communicate with healthcare providers. Mobile apps can offer additional features such as medication reminders, symptom trackers, and telemedicine capabilities. By making healthcare services easily accessible and convenient, patient portals and mobile apps can drive patient engagement and improve overall satisfaction.

7. Measuring the Success of Healthcare Marketing Strategies

To ensure the effectiveness of healthcare marketing strategies, it’s essential to measure key performance indicators (KPIs) and track the success of campaigns. This allows healthcare providers to identify what works and what needs improvement, ultimately optimizing patient engagement efforts.

Common KPIs in healthcare marketing include website traffic, conversion rates, social media engagement, email open rates, and patient satisfaction scores. By regularly monitoring these metrics and analyzing the data, healthcare providers can make data-driven decisions and continuously improve their marketing strategies for maximum patient engagement.
